Strong's Concordance
taom: twins
Original Word: תְאוֹמִיםPart of Speech: Noun Masculine
Transliteration: taom
Phonetic Spelling: (taw-ome')
Short Definition: twins
Brown-Driver-Briggs
[ (Kö
ii. 1. 69 )]
(Late Hebrew id.; compare Phoenician proper name, masculine , Greek = John 20:24); — plural absolute of two boys Genesis 25:24 (Ges§ 23f.) Genesis 38:27 (both J); of animals, construct Cant 4:5, Cant 7:4.
Strong's Exhaustive Concordance
twins
Or taom {taw-ome'}; from ta'am; a twin (in plural only), literally or figuratively -- twins.
